Why Budapest is Embracing Solar Energy
With rising electricity prices and climate commitments, Budapest has seen a 47% increase in rooftop PV installations since 2020. The city's unique position offers:
- 4.2 average daily sun hours – comparable to Vienna
- Government subsidies covering up to 30% of installation costs
- Net metering programs allowing energy sell-back

Cost-Benefit Analysis (Typical 5kW System)
| Item | Cost Range |
|---|---|
| Equipment | €3,200-€4,800 |
| Installation | €1,800-€3,200 |
| Total Before Subsidy | €5,000-€8,000 |
| 25-Year Savings | €15,000+ |
4-Step Installation Process
- Site Assessment: Engineers evaluate roof structure and orientation
- Permit Acquisition: Average approval time: 2-4 weeks
- System Installation: Typically completed within 3-5 days
- Grid Connection: Final inspection and activation

Choosing Reliable Providers
When selecting installers, verify:
- MEKH certification (Hungarian Energy Authority)
- Minimum 5 years local experience
- Comprehensive service packages

Frequently Asked Questions
Can I install panels on historic buildings?
Special permits required – success rate averages 65% for protected structures.
What's the optimal panel angle?
34-38 degrees for maximum Budapest sun exposure.
